Minimalistic Noma Yoruk Tiny House has an Open-Floor Layout

Conveys a sense of calmness, and spacious enough for four people to sleep comfortably

Measuring 17 feet long, 8 feet wide, and 13 feet high, Noma Yoruk tiny house is built by Spain-based Noma Tiny House. The company focuses on maximizing comfort in a compact space, and built this micro-dwelling to be practical, comfortable, and charming. It has an open plan layout with a loft bedroom, so it comfortably sleeps up to four people.

This tiny house is one of the company’s compact models and has a robust exterior made from natural, eco-friendly material. There are windows and an entry door for natural light to filter inside the house. The interior boasts 182 square feet of living space that accommodates a kitchen, a living area, a bathroom, and a loft bedroom.

As you step inside, the cozy living area welcomes you. It is a minimal space with a sofa bed that transforms into an additional bed, and a foldable table with shelves and wheels for accessibility. The living area is effortlessly versatile and smoothly maximizes the use of space.

Adjacent is the hallway-type kitchen with a countertop, a sink, ample under-counter drawers and cabinets. For additional storage, the staircase parallel to the kitchen has been integrated with cabinets that can be well-utilized for storing additional kitchen essentials like spices. There is also a cooktop, a chimney, a microwave, and a designated refrigerator space. The kitchen is complete with all the other essentials and offers great functionality.

Next to the kitchen is a fully functional bathroom, enclosed by a sliding. This section is equipped with a shower, a vanity sink, and a toilet. Defying the space limitations, this tiny house gives the dwellers access to all the fundamental necessities, including a loft bedroom. The sleeping area lies above the bathroom and is accessible via stairs from the kitchen.

It features a queen-size mattress, loft storage for clothes, books, and other decorative stuff. A window keeps this whole space bright and welcoming. The storage unit also doubles as a half wall, ensuring privacy for those who love to sleep in a quiet, undisturbed environment. Noma Yoruk tiny house on wheels emanates a sense of calm, while, its minimal and clever layout is built to fulfill the modern needs of a dweller.
